Participants will learn how to capture and reuse rainwater at home. They will construct a rain barrel to bring home. Adding a rain barrel to your home or green space conserves water, reduces runoff, prevents erosion, and protects the health of Atlanta’s streams. In a changing climate, a rain barrel system is a great backup for watering trees and plants on your patch of Atlanta’s urban forest. Bonus- option to watch this City Forest Certified training video. Participants will construct a compost bin and learn how to transform food scraps into nutrient-rich compost. Participants get to bring the compost bin they construct home! Adding compost to our patch of Atlanta’s urban forest improves the health of our urban soils, and the resilience of plants and trees in your yard. Participants can bring their bin home.
